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 3.4.21.77glycoprotein a single N-linked carbohydrate side chain is attached to Asn45 647582
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 3.4.21.77glycoprotein an N-linked carbohydrate side chain is predicted at Asp45, and O-linked carbohydrate side chains are possibly attached to Ser69, Thr70 and Ser71 647583
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 3.4.21.77glycoprotein complex structure of the oligosaccharide 647582
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 3.4.21.77glycoprotein the relative abundance of glycosylated PSA isoforms is not correlated with total PSA protein levels measured in the same prostate cancer tissue samples by clinical immunoassay. The sialylated PSA is differentially distributed in cancer and noncancer tissues, and elevated in cancer tissues compared to noncancerous tissues 717088
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 3.4.21.77proteolytic modification enzyme can be activated by recombinant kallikrein 2 647332, 647590
